ABSTRACT

Objective To evaluate the usefulness of real-time three-dimensional transesophageal echocardiography(RT-3D-TEE)in cardiac valvular diseases.Methods Preoperative and postoperative RT-3D-TEE studies were performed in 32 patients who had undertaken cardiac valve repair or valvular replacement using Philips iE33 with X7-2 probe,and quantitative analysed the mitral structure in cases of mitral valve prolapse by using online QLAB7.0 quantitative analysis software.Results RT-3D-TEE can demonstrate the anatomicsl structure clearly,evaluate the function of cardiac valves precisely,and reveal details of type,position and extent of lesions vividly in surgical view.RT-3D-TEE helped correct misdiagnose in 2 cases,revised surgical plans in 3 cases,and guided implementation of remedial surgery in 1 case.Conclusions RT-3D-TEE can present images lively,and it can provide adequate information for preoperative diagnosis,aid the formulation of surgical plan and evaluate surgical effect.

ABSTRACT

Objective To research the feasibility and accuracy on echocardiography measurement aortic annulus diameter(AAD)at the plane of three Junctions of aortic valve leaflets by real-time three-dimensional transesophageal echocardiography(RT-3D-TEE).Methods Twenty-three patients underwent echocardiography and aortic valve replacement because of acquired aortic valve disease.The AAD was measured in parasternal left ventricle long axis view(TTE-AAD)by transthoracic echocardiography(TTE)preoperative.The AAD was measured in left ventricle long axis view(TEE-AAD)and the distance of three iunctions of aortic valve leaflets (N,L,R) was measured in aortic short axis view by RT-3D-TEE intraoperative.The three-dimensional full volume images were analyzed by online QLAB 7.0 software.The AAD was measured by standard cylindrical valve sizer (OP-AAD)before aortic valve replacement surgery,too.Results Comparing with the three aortic valve leaflets of acquired aortic valve disease,the lines between their junctions constituted an approximate equilateral triangle regardless of the cause and degree of disease,and the length of the three groups was no significant difference(P>0.05).There was no significant difference between TTE-AAD and OP-AAD group(P>0.05),and the correlation was good(r=0.84).The N,L and R group compared separately with the OP-AAD group, there was no significant difference(P>0.05)and correlation was superior to TTE-AAD group(r=0.94, 0.97, 0.96).The difference between TEE-AAD and OP-AAD were significant(P<0.01).Conclusions Echocardiography measurement of AAD at the plane of three junctions of aortic valve leaflets is feasible,and it is better accuracy and repeatability comparing with parasternal left ventricle long axis view.

ABSTRACT

Background and objective Pre-operative assessment of mitral valve(MV)anatomy is essential to surgical design in patientsundergoing MV repair.Although 2-dimensional(2D)echocardiography provides precise information regarding MV anatomy,RT-3DTEE could increase the understanding of MV apparatus and individual scallop identification.We aimed to investigate the value of RT-3DTEE in MV repair. Methods RT-3DTEE was performed in six patients with mitral valve prolapse(MVP) by using Philips IE33with X7-2t probe.Preoperative RT-3DTEE studies were compared with surgical findings in patients undergoing surgical mitral valverepair,and quantitative evaluation was performed by QLab 6.0 software before and after surgicalmitralvalve repair.Results RT-3DTEE could display dynamic morphology of MV,the location of prolapse,and spatial relation to the surrounding tissue.It couldprovide surgical views of the valves and the valvular apparatus.These resuIts were consistent with surgical findings.The quantitativeevahuation before and after surgical MV repair indicated that anterolateral to posteromedial diameter of annalus.anterior to posteriordiameter of annulus,perimeter of annullus.,and area of annalus in projectionplane were significantlv smaller after operation comparedwith those before operation(P<0.05).The length of posterior leaflet,,the area of anterior and posterior leaflet,the maximal prolapseheight,the volume of leaflet prolapse and the length of coaptation in projection planewere significantly reduced after operation(P<0.05).Conclusion RT-3DTEE is a unique new medality for rapid and accurate evaluation of mitral valve prolapse and miwal valverepair.

ABSTRACT

Atrial flutter, a common rhythm disturbance, was first described over 80 years ago. Despite extensive investigations, several important issues remain unresolved concerning its exact mechanism and management. Present therapeutic strategies often appear effective to prevent and terminate atrial flutter. However, controlled trial and definitive studies comparing the various treatment options are surprisingly scarce. Here we report on a study of 9 episodes of spontaneous atrial flutter(AF)(flutter wave cycle length 224+/-39 msec) treatedd by transesophageal atrial pacing(TAP) in 9 patients(7 men and 2 women; mean age 56.9 yrs). TAP was effective in 5 patients : sinus rhythm resumption was immediate in 3 patients and followed a short period of atrial fibrillation in 2 patients. TAP was unsuccessful in 4 patients. All the patients tolerated the procedure well. These data strongly support the immediate first choice use of TAP in AF therapy.
